Как сделать Android-приложение без использования Android Studio?

Я загрузил студию Android и установил ее. Когда я запустил его, он все «графический». Мой экранный считыватель ничего не читает.

Я бы предпочел, если бы я мог использовать свое приложение «Блокнот», но «самостоятельные» учебники слишком утомительны, и не многие учебные пособия в Интернете имеют инструкции по созданию приложений с помощью Notepad. Я хотел знать, есть ли альтернативная среда IDE или другой способ кодировать приложения для Android?

Java IDE Eclipse также не очень совместим с моим устройством чтения с экрана. Я использую программу чтения JAWS от Freedom Scientific. Я использовал для кодирования программного обеспечения для рабочего стола Java, используя мой блокнот, поэтому я знаком с программированием с помощью Блокнота.

Кроме того, если я каким-то образом выясню, как делать приложения для Android с помощью Notepad, как я буду их тестировать? Нужен ли мне телефон? Мне жаль всех этих начинающих вопросов, но я новичок 🙂

Solutions Collecting From Web of "Как сделать Android-приложение без использования Android Studio?"

Вы можете перейти по этой ссылке: http://developer.android.com/tools/building/building-cmdline.html Если вы хотите строить, а не запускать, вам не нужен телефон. Если вы хотите протестировать без телефона, вы можете использовать эмулятор, запустив «AVD Manager.exe» в папке Android SDK.

Хорошая вещь с момента перехода на студию android заключается в том, что теперь проект андроида выполняется с использованием Gradle и может быть полностью пилотирован по командной строке. Так что технически вам вообще не нужна IDE.

В принципе, каждый проект имеет в списке файлы build.gradle , содержащие инструкции по его созданию, и вам нужно только запустить Gradle с помощью соответствующей команды для компиляции вашего приложения.

Yelliver упомянул инструменты для создания приложения из командной строки, есть также инструменты для создания структуры проекта и основных файлов сборки: http://developer.android.com/tools/projects/projects-cmdline.html (эта документация Кажется, не совсем обновлен, хотя, поскольку он упоминает старый формат project.properties )

Наличие телефона для запуска вашего приложения, безусловно, будет лучше и быстрее развиваться. Эмулятор далеко не совершенен, довольно медленный, а иногда и не реагирует. Также проще устанавливать другие приложения на телефоне, чем на эмулятор, в случае, если ваше приложение взаимодействует с другими приложениями.